Saturday was our first day off. Therefore, we decided to go to Porvoo, a beautiful old city 4 hours away from Helsinki by boat. Even though it was our day off, we were brave and got up early, took a train to Helsinki and the boat to Porvoo. The weather was quite cold and windy in the morning, but it got better during the day.

We discovered Porvoo and its old wooden houses. The trip was really interesting as we were not used to seeing such houses, in Finland as well as in our country. Unfortunately, we stayed there for only one hour and a half, but it was enough to have a good idea of the spirit of the city.

During the way back to Helsinki, the weather was warmer, so we could stay outside on the boat. We saw wonderful landscapes, and were lucky to have the lunch on board.

After a quick sauna, we went to sleep. It was a great day!

Today has been the last working day of the week. We went to ‘’Snake Island’’ for cleaning up.

We got up early and went to the Espoo harbour, where we took two boats to reach this little island. The boys had to cut apart some old wooden blocks, and carry them to the shore, and the rest of the group had to clean up the area. For lunch we had some grilled Makkara: very tasty! Apart from the mosquitos and the rain, it has been a good experience.

As soon as we got home we took a long siesta, and after the daily sauna we went to sleep, getting ready for the next day.
